About Myriad
Myriad Genetics is a healthcare company that provides genetic tests to help doctors and patients make more informed care decisions. Our tests help identify disease risk, support diagnosis and treatment planning, and guide care in areas such as oncology, women’s health, and mental health. Myriad has a long history in genetic testing and is focused on making personalized medicine easier to access, understand, and use in everyday healthcare.

What you need to know about the NYC Tech Scene
Key Facts About NYC Tech
- Number of Tech Workers: 549,200; 6%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
- Major Tech Employers: Capgemini, Bloomberg, IBM, Spotify
-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, Fintech
- Funding Landscape: $25.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
- Notable Investors: Greycroft, Thrive Capital, Union Square Ventures, FirstMark Capital, Tiger Global Management, Tribeca Venture Partners, Insight Partners, Two Sigma Ventures
- Research Centers and Universities: Columbia University, New York University, Fordham University, CUNY, AI Now Institute, Flatiron Institute, C.N. Yang Institute for Theoretical Physics, NASA Space Radiation Laboratory
